ESTABLISHED · QUALITY · SINCE {date('Y')-10}

从需求分析到上线部署:软件开发全生命周期质量管控要点

首页 / 新闻资讯 / 从需求分析到上线部署:软件开发全生命周期

从需求分析到上线部署:软件开发全生命周期质量管控要点

📅 2026-06-04 🔖 重庆知梦科技有限公司,互联网科技,软件开发,小程序开发,APP 定制,文创科技,数字服务

过去几年,我们接触过不少企业客户,他们常常陷入一个怪圈:前期需求沟通顺利,开发进度看似正常,但一到测试阶段就发现大量逻辑漏洞,甚至上线后频繁崩溃。这背后,往往是缺乏对软件开发全生命周期的系统性管控,导致需求失真、代码质量滑坡。作为深耕互联网科技领域的重庆知梦科技有限公司,我们深知,真正靠谱的软件开发,绝非“代码写完就了事”。

一、需求分析:别让“我以为”成为项目黑洞

很多项目的失败,根源都在需求阶段。团队常犯的错误是:产品经理将模糊的“老板想法”直接转为PRD,开发人员拿到文档就动手编码。结果就是,做出来的功能并非客户真正想要的。我们曾在小程序开发项目中,通过引入“用户故事地图”和“原型验证会”,将需求理解偏差率从行业平均的35%降至8%。关键做法包括:

  • 与客户共同绘制业务流程图,而非单纯记录功能列表;
  • 用高保真原型进行三轮确认,确保每个交互细节都被验证;
  • 建立需求变更档案,每次变更都评估对工期和成本的影响。

只有把“甲方想要”翻译成“可执行的开发语言”,后续环节才不至于跑偏。

二、技术解析与对比:从代码规范到自动化测试

进入开发阶段,质量管控的核心在于标准和工具。我们曾对比过两个APP 定制项目:一个项目采用“先写代码后补测试”,另一个项目则强制实施代码审查制度每日构建自动化测试。结果前者在集成测试阶段发现了127个缺陷,修复成本是后者的4.3倍。具体来说,我们推崇以下做法:

  1. 代码规范自动化:用SonarQube等工具扫描,强制规则包括函数复杂度不超过10、禁止硬编码;
  2. 单元测试覆盖率不低于85%,核心业务模块需要达到100%;
  3. 接口联调前置:在前后端并行开发时,通过Mock服务提前验证数据交互。

这套体系让重庆知梦科技有限公司软件开发项目,上线后线上Bug率被控制在0.5%以内,远低于行业3%的平均水平。

三、部署与运维:最后一公里的稳定性守护

上线不是终点,而是质量管控的新起点。许多团队在部署环节掉以轻心,导致生产环境配置错误、数据库迁移失败。我们的解决方案是实施“灰度发布+全链路监控”。例如在文创科技项目中,我们采用金丝雀发布策略:先让5%的用户使用新版本,观察性能指标(如P99响应时间、错误日志量)持续稳定15分钟后,再逐步全量推送。同时,通过Prometheus和Grafana搭建监控看板,实时追踪数字服务的调用链。

小程序开发APP 定制项目中,我们还特别强调“回滚预案”的文档化。每个版本都必须包含一键回滚脚本,并经过预演测试。这样即使遇到极端情况,也能在3分钟内恢复服务。

作为一家专注于互联网科技的技术服务商,重庆知梦科技有限公司始终认为:质量不是测试出来的,而是从需求分析那一刻就开始设计的。如果你正在为项目质量头疼,不妨从上述节点逐一排查,或许能找到问题的根源。毕竟,好的产品,永远诞生于严谨的流程之中。

相关推荐

📄

重庆知梦科技文创数字服务在文旅行业的应用案例

2026-05-26

📄

重庆知梦科技数字服务在医疗健康领域的隐私合规设计

2026-05-05

📄

文创科技数字服务在文旅行业的落地实践

2026-05-06

📄

基于微服务架构的重庆知梦科技软件开发性能优化实践

2026-05-09

📄

小程序与APP在用户行为分析中的技术差异

2026-05-05

📄

重庆知梦科技数字服务在智慧教育场景的学习管理平台设计

2026-05-07